Step 1: Enter the Jiggle Zone (Because Apparently Wiggle Mode Was Taken)

First things first, we gotta get those apps jigglin'. Hold down your finger on any blank space on your home screen until everything starts to… well, jiggle. Don't worry, your phone isn't possessed by a rogue polka band. This is the gateway to editing nirvana!

Step 2: The Widget Wild West: Adding and Subtracting

See that little plus sign in the top left corner? That, my friend, is your portal to a world of widgets. Tap it and prepare to be overwhelmed by the sheer number of options. Weather, news, stocks, even a widget that tells you if it's a good day to wear pants (although, hopefully, your common sense can handle that one).

Adding widgets is easy - just tap the one you want and choose the size. Think of it like choosing a Goldilocks widget - not too small, not too big, just the right amount of info for your home screen real estate.

Feeling like you went a little overboard with the widgets? No problem! Just hold down the offending widget and tap the little minus sign that magically appears. Poof! Widget wasteland averted.

Step 3: Widget Wrangling: Rearranging and Editing

Now that you've got your widgets chosen, it's time to wrangle those suckers into place. Just hold down any widget and drag it wherever your heart desires. Think of yourself as a digital interior decorator, but instead of arguing with clients about throw pillows, you're battling the tyranny of tiny squares.

Some widgets offer a bit more customization. Tap and hold a widget, then look for an "Edit Widget" option. Here you might be able to change the city displayed in your weather widget, or choose which news stories show up. It's basically like playing dress-up for your widgets!

Pro Tip: Want to create a super-stacked widget situation? Drag a couple of widgets on top of each other and create a "Smart Stack." Your iPhone will then cycle through the widgets based on the time of day or your activity.
